The story

Before you pull up to 1542 South East Street, you have a job to do. The building in Bates-Hendricks carries neighborhood bank robber lore, so naturally, they don't leave the front door unlocked. To get inside this women-owned lounge, you have to decipher a four-digit clue posted on their social media channels and punch the numbers into an exterior door keypad yourself.

If the lock clicks, you step straight into a space anchored by vintage bank-vault details. Rather than leaning into gimmickry, the spot operates as a focused spirits house, building its drink list around small-batch bourbons, local Indiana distillers, and custom cocktail pairings to match a curated food menu.

How do I find the door code for entry?

Check the venue's official Instagram (@thevault.indy) or Facebook page before you go—they post the four-digit keypad entry clues on their social channels.

Where is The Vault Indy located?

It is located at 1542 S East St in the historic Bates-Hendricks neighborhood of Indianapolis.

What kind of food and drinks do they serve?

The bar highlights small-batch bourbons, local spirits, and house cocktails, paired with charcuterie spreads and a dedicated food menu.
